CHECK-IN/HOURS:    Check-in is from 7:30AM to 8:30 AM BOTH DAYSJudging begins at 9:00 AM BOTH DAYS.  Advertised show hours are 9AM to 4PM.  This is a non-vetted show.  All cats must be checked in through the show committee on BOTH DAYS.  The show hall is climate-controlled.  It is strongly advised that all entries be inoculated for enteritis, rhinotracheitis, calici virus, and rabies, and given at least two weeks prior to the show.  All claws must be trimmed and if not, claws will be trimmed at exhibitor’s expense.  Kittens must be at least four months old to be in the show hall.

NOVICE EXHIBITORS: Bring grooming aids and curtains or towels for the cages, which are about 24” deep, 24” wide and 22” high.

 

LITTER AND FOOD:  Litter will be furnished as donated.  Litter pans will not be provided.  Cat food will be furnished as donated.

 

HOUSEHOLD PETS:   Household pets will be judged in all rings.  Kittens will be judged with adults in all rings.  Please indicate if your HHP is long or short haired.  Per show rules, HHP kittens, 4 months to 8 months of age, may be altered or unaltered.  Adults, 8 months and older, must be altered.

 

TRANSFERS:             Transfers will be accepted by the Master Clerk during the show on Saturday and prior to judging on Sunday.  No transfers will be accepted on Sunday after judging begins.  Bring information from your prior wins.

 

CLERKS & STEWARDS:  We pay licensed clerks according to ACFA Show Rules, nonlicensed clerks $20/day.  Stewards are paid $10/day.  Please indicate on your entry form if you would be willing to clerk or steward.  Submit entry forms and fees for all cats.  We will notify you if you are needed to clerk or steward.  You will be paid after the show.  Lunch and beverages will also be provided.  We need and appreciate you!!

 

ADVERTISING:   Non-commercial rates on summary.  Enclose sharp black & white copy with entry.  You may sponsor a ring for $100 per day.  Please contact the show manager immediately if you are interested.

 

VENDORS:           A limited number of sales booth spaces are available.  No one is permitted to sell anything from their cages.  Contact the show manager if you are interested.

 

SALES CAGES:     These are available for breeders who are also exhibiting cats or kittens at this show.  No kittens or cats may be sold from carriers beneath the benching area.  All kittens must be 4 months old to be in the show hall.  We support serious breeders and it is suggested that no purebred kittens be sold in the show hall for less than $150.  All cats and kittens offered for sale must have valid health certificate and be an ACFA recognized breed.  Cotee River encourages spay/neuter agreements!
